Lady Terps Grab #2 Seed in NCAA Tournamnent
May 4th, 2009 · No Comments
The Lady Terps (Lacrosse) earned the #2 seed in the NCAA tourney with its 19-0 undefeated season. The first game is against Colgate on Sunday at the Field Hockey Complex at College Park. Northwestern, Pemm, Virginia, and Duke are in the other half of the draw.

Karri Ellen Johnson Scores 5. Leading #6 Terps to 17-6 Victory in over Richmond in Lacrosse
February 16th, 2009 · No Comments
In her first collegiate game, Freshman Karri Ellen Johnson from Broadneck High tallied 5 goals with 5 draw controls in a 17-6 blowout win.The Jones sister tandem combined for seven points on five goals and two assists. ”I think this was a good way to start the 2009 season,” head coach Cathy Reese said.
